Booting
If the system freezes or locks up during normal operation, you
can reset the system by performing a reboot. The reboot method
depends on the desired state of the CV60 PC system.
Warm Boot
Perform a warm-boot when you need to clear the system’s mem-
ory to run another program but do not want the PC to perform a
self-test.
Note: You must have a keyboard or keyboard emulator
attached to the system before performing a warm-boot.
Terminal emulations remap the keyboard, thus a
warm-boot is not possible from within this program.
1 Press <Ctrl> + <Alt> + <Del> simultaneously on the keyboard
to force the system to boot.
2 Reload the desired software application, if necessary.
Cold Boot
Perform a cold-boot when the screen is frozen, or the system is
otherwise locked up. The cold-boot is essentially a power-up
sequence. Press the power ON/OFF switch to shut off the CV60,
then press the switch again to reset the CV60 PC back on.
